The nursing instructor is holding a clinical discussion with students in a renal unit in the hospital. The instructor asks about what is the smallest structure in the kidneys that forms urine.

The correct answer is nephron. The nephron is the smallest structure in the kidneys that forms urine, and it is composed of the renal corpuscle and the renal tubule.
